Only Administrator-level users can issue this command. Other restrictions
include:
If the "reset" command is executed, the modified banner will remain modified.
However, the "reset config/reset system" command will reset the modified
banner to the original factory banner.
The capacity of the banner is 6*80. 6 Lines and 80 characters per line.
Ctrl+W will only save the modified banner in the DRAM. Users need to type
the "save config/save all" command to save it into Flash.
Only valid in threshold level.
